Post by tagger »

This brings back memories. I wish I still had mine.

I notice that there are plain threaded camber/toe links on yours. Did it come to you like that? Mine had turnbuckles.

Re: Used Optima Mid SE

Post by keithrc »

Of the 3 SWB Mids, only the Turbo Mid came with turnbuckles, the standard Mid and the SE both came with the plain tie rods.
